Barolo Rocche di Castiglione 2020
Rocche di Castiglione is prized for its pure white, chalky soils, which produce wines of exceptional finesse and a wide range of flavors. For lovers of timeless Nebbiolo, it is a real hit. The vines are located not far from the winery, which blends into the stone walls and urban fabric of the village of Castiglione Falletto. Rocche di Castiglione is a curiously shaped and elongated Cru with a unique southeast exposure along a steep ravine that yields fruit that produces a straightforward Barolo with precision, structure, and balanced freshness. This naturally concentrated vintage also displays a juicy quality that is simply outstanding. Pretty mineral notes contribute to the balance and elegance.
"a magical wine from a magical vineyard. It combines finesse and volume to an extent not found in most other wines in this range. Castiglione Falletto is the center of the Barolo growing area, where many different types of soil come together. Barolo Cerequio 2020
Cerequio is a naturally-shaped amphitheater of vines divided into southwest and southeast-facing parts. In 2018, Vietti acquired vines in the southwestern exposure, considered the better of the two and the crème de la crème of the Barolo Crus. It's no coincidence that the labels that have made Barolo history are all from here.
"The 2020 Barolo Cerequio once again confirms that buying this vineyard is one of the smartest decisions Vietti ever made. A wine of nuance and class, Cerequio captures all the pedigree of this great site. Crushed red berry fruit, kirsch, blood orange, spice, and mint soar out of the glass, all framed by nervy tannins that convey classicism. This is an exotic, racy Barolo."
